Intended use
Your Black & Decker food chopper has been designed for
chopping, beating and mixing food and beverage ingredients.
This product is intended for household use only.

Double insulation
This appliance is double insulated in accordance
with EN 60335; therefore no earth wire is required.
Always check that the power supply corresponds to
the voltage on the rating plate.
To avoid the risk of electric shock, do not immerse
the cord, plug or motor unit in water or other liquid.
